A reconstruction of George IV's visit to Edinburgh in 1822 drawing a contrast between the old town and the New Town which the King was able to see in development. (15 mins)
One of a series of films made about life in Dumfries Academy 1955-1978, this film was shot by pupils in the academic year 1969-1970, and includes several "in-jokes".

The provincial government of Prussia applied for revocation of permission of the film "Ums tägliche Brot (Hunger in Waldenburg)" at the censorship headquarter in Berlin. The application was accepted.
The production company "Ring - Film A.G., Berlin" applied against the ban of the film "Ehrlichkeit ist aller Laster Anfang" at the censorship headquarter in Berlin. The application was rejected.

The production company "Naturfilm Hubert Schonger, Berlin" applied against the partial ban of the film "Zeugen aus grosser Zeit" at the censorship headquarter in Berlin. The application was rejected.
The production company "Karl Otto Krause-Film, Berlin" applied against the ban of the film "Gauner, Dieb & Co" at the censorship headquarter in Berlin. The application was rejected.
